Frequently Asked Questions about Portland

What type of rentals are currently available in Portland?

There are currently 6583 Apartments for Rent in Portland, OR with pricing that ranges from $470 to $37,100. There are also 1107 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Portland ranging from $615 to $13,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Portland?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Portland ranges from $615 to $13,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,729.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Portland?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Portland range from $1,458 to $10,364,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,695 to $13,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,295 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,902.
